Transaction 8b7af8f3fbf38c4e21b5d76cd09744268841a8e2b527bf6f2201ec39ddf41285
1 Input
1 Output
-
8b7af8f3fbf38c4e21b5d76cd09744268841a8e2b527bf6f2201ec39ddf41285:0
- value
- 29143785
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ed0fa3fb2ac786276beba63ae3803405aa5acdbe
- address
- bc1qa58687e2c7rzw6lt5caw8qp5qk494nd7geytaa